> Sasquatch sighting reported by Tensed woman
>
> A 50-year-old Tensed woman driving south on U.S. Highway 95 reported
> seeing a sasquatch chasing a deer on the side of the road late Wednesday
> night near milepost 367 north of Potlatch, according to the Latah County
> Sheriff’s Office.
>
> She told the sheriff’s office she checked one of her mirrors to take a
> second look at the 7- to 8-foot tall “shaggy” object and after she
> refocused her eyes onto the road the deer ran in front of her. She struck
> it with her Subaru Forester.
>
> The woman continued driving her damaged vehicle to Pullman to pick up her
> husband from work. She arrived at the sheriff’s office around 12:30 a.m.
> Thursday to report the incident. She had previously reported it to the
> Idaho State Police, but the call was forwarded to the sheriff's department.
>
> A deputy followed the woman out to the scene of the crash, which she said
> occurred around 11 p.m. Wednesday night, and the deputy requested a case
> file for a vehicle versus deer collision but the report did not indicate
> evidence of Bigfoot.
>
> The woman reported neck pain as a result of the collision but she was not
> transported by emergency personnel.
